MEET ANN

Ann Romero-Parks started her collegiate volleyball career at Concordia University before transferring to play for University of California at Riverside her last three years, where she played for Sue Gozansky and Monica Trainer.

Ann Romero-Parks is the Varsity coach at Murrieta Valley High School and will continue to be involved at the highest level  of coaching at Forza1. Last season her varsity team went to CIF and State finals!

In 2019 Ann helped coach the 18UA team with Dana to a 1st place finish in SCVA, a Gold Medal at LAs Vegas Classic and a 5th place finish at USA Nationals! In 2018 Ann coached with Dana Burkholder on the 18UA team finishing 2nd place in all of SCVA! In 2017 Ann coached the 15UA team with Dak Sivertson where they led the team to a silver medal at the 2017 USA National Championships. In 2016 Ann was the Assistant Coach on our 15UA team that finished 5th in SCVA. In 2015, Ann was the assistant coach on Forza1 17-1s and helped lead the team to a 13th place finish at USA Junior Nationals in the Open Divison. As a passionate player and former setter, Ann is gifted at helping players improve and perform with confidence. Ann played an integral part in attacking the opposing teams systems and managing the service reception. In 2014, Ann was an assistant on an 18-2s that competed in the Gold Division all year.

For the last 10+ years Ann has been a varsity assistant at Murrieta Valley High School, reaching the CIF quarter finals three times and the semi-finals once. 
Ann earned a BA in liberal studies with an emphasis in education and sociology from UCR and currently teaches in the Murrieta Valley School District. She recently finished her Masters Degree.
She and her husband Sean have three kids and enjoy the outdoors.
